Montey's Story
Montey is thoughtful, gentle, and quietly charming — the kind of puppy who makes you slow down and smile. As the only boy in the Chunky Litter, he carries himself like a true little gentleman, moving through the world with calm curiosity and an observant nature that feels wise beyond his age.<br/><br/>Born on Thanksgiving Day, Montey has a beautiful balance between independence and affection. He enjoys exploring his surroundings at his own pace, taking everything in before deciding when it’s time to come back in close for love. He’s just as content checking things out on his own as he is curling up for a cuddle when the moment feels right.<br/><br/>Montey is people-oriented without being demanding — he likes being near his humans, part of the household rhythm, without needing constant attention. He adapts well to routines, settles easily, and brings a steady, grounding presence to the home.<br/><br/>He would thrive in a home with another calm, friendly pup sibling to share both playtime and downtime.
